Itawamba Agricultural Softball Team Makes History

The Itawamba Agricultural softball team made history on Saturday by winning the school’s first-ever MHSAA Class 4A state title with a two-game sweep of Purvis.

Championship Overview

  • Game Results:
    • Game 1: Itawamba Agricultural won 6-2.
    • Game 2: The Indians secured a 9-6 victory.

This championship win marked the team’s first appearance in the championship game.

Key Players

  • Abbie Robertson:
    • Junior catcher named series MVP.
    • Performance:
      • Batting average: .375
      • Four RBIs
      • Two runs scored

Robertson expressed her pride in being part of the team, stating, "It feels amazing."

Defensive Highlights

In addition to her offensive contributions, Robertson excelled defensively, throwing out three baserunners attempting to steal second base during both games.
